Delphos city, Ohio: commercial real estate data.

Delphos city is a Census city of 7,143 people across 3.32 square miles of land, lying across Allen County and Van Wert County. Median household income is $61,037, 72.1 percent of occupied homes are owned, and the SBA record carries 2 7(a) approvals to borrowers here worth $2.3 m.

Common questions

Delphos questions, answered from the record.

How many people live in Delphos, Ohio?

7,143, in 3,128 households. Delphos city covers 3.32 square miles of land, which is 2,150 people per square mile.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.

What county is Delphos in?

Delphos lies in more than one. By area it is 58.8 percent in Allen County, 41.2 percent in Van Wert County. This page sits under Allen County because that county holds the largest share. The split is measured from the Census boundary of the place against the county boundaries.

What is the median household income in Delphos?

$61,037. The median owner-occupied home is valued at $129,600. Median gross rent is $812 per month.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
